底抽巷开挖应力分布与变形破坏特征数值分析 被引量:2

Numerical Analysis on Stress Distribution and Deformation and Failure Characteristics for Floor Gas Drainage Roadway Excavation

摘要 底抽巷抽采瓦斯是解决高瓦斯煤层巷道掘进瓦斯突出问题的重要保障。结合贵州大方煤业小屯煤矿16中03工作面具体工程条件,对小屯矿底抽巷的开挖应力分布与变形破坏特征进行数值分析。结果表明:该底抽巷对其上运输煤巷的影响较小,底抽巷的位置设计参数合理。 Gas excavation in the floor gas drainage roadway is the good solution to prevent gas outburst in roadway excavation of the gas- sy coal seam. Combined with the specific project conditions of the 16-mido03 working face in Xiaotun Coal Mine,the stress distribution, deformation and failure characteristics of the floor gas drainage roadway excavation were studied by numerical analysis in this paper. The results show that : the floor gas drainage roadway has little impact on the transportation roadway in the coal; the design parameters of the under-floor-gas-drainage-roadway are rational.
